The libmetal library is maintained by the OpenAMP open source community. It provides common user APIs to access devices, handle device interrupts, and request memory across different operating environments.
libmetal is available for the following operating systems/software configurations:
- Linux (Linux user space based on Uniform I/O (UIO) and Virtual Function I/O (VFIO) support in the kernel.)
- FreeRTOS
- Bare-metal environments
